const require_pad = require("../../string/pad.js");
const require_toString = require("../util/toString.js");
//#region src/compat/string/pad.ts
/**
* Pads string on the left and right sides if it's shorter than length. Padding characters are truncated if they can't be evenly divided by length.
* If the length is less than or equal to the original string's length, or if the padding character is an empty string, the original string is returned unchanged.
*
* @param {string} str - The string to pad.
* @param {number} [length] - The length of the resulting string once padded.
* @param {string} [chars] - The character(s) to use for padding.
* @returns {string} - The padded string, or the original string if padding is not required.
*
* @example
* const result1 = pad('abc', 8); // result will be ' abc '
* const result2 = pad('abc', 8, '_-'); // result will be '_-abc_-_'
* const result3 = pad('abc', 3); // result will be 'abc'
* const result4 = pad('abc', 2); // result will be 'abc'
*
*/
function pad(str, length, chars) {
return require_pad.pad(require_toString.toString(str), length, chars);
}
//#endregion
exports.pad = pad;
